I purchased a damaged OLED Switch model from my local pawn shop. The motherboard was damaged and beyond my current ability to repair. When looking at replacements online, I found a modded, but banned, oled motherboard was going for the same price as unbanned motherboards on ebay. So I pulled the trigger on this!

aliexpress


But man am I struggling to get this working! I'm not convinced if this is any issue with the modchip itself as it always boots, and hekate is fully stable. Sidenote: I have a first-generation switch that I've used to confirm that the nsp files work. I've never had these problems with that switch


Symptoms:

• When launching into atmosphere, it will sometimes get a black screen crash after the switch logo.
• Tinfoil does not run. The installer produces an error or crashes. I can't remember it exactly but I can look it up if relevant! The NSP file installs using goldleaf, but then my switch ALWAYS crashes at some point while tinfoil is loading things in. The screen freezes on whatever is there, have to long press the power button.
• tinwoo runs, but then it always freezes during the installation of nsp files.
• Goldleaf runs rock solid!
• Running the NSP that I installed (confirmed nsp on gen1 switch). It makes it to the switch logo screen, then freezes on a black screen. I've found that the volume sometimes is functional, though it is otherwise frozen and I have to long press the start button to work again.
• Out of probably 50 tries, the NSP ran once while I was fiddling with the volume. It showed a message about the user not being connected online, but my god the game ran! My hope was quickly;y dashed as I was never able to replicate this.
• I have tried on NSP games. Some are more stable, but those too will occasionally crash on boot.
• Switch cartridge games run just fine. They don't freeze at all, only the homebrew related stuff is super unstable as far as I can tell thus far.

What have I tried?

Process I use to wipe / reset SD card
I've wiped the SD card. Formatted in hekat, always, choosing full partition
- created emuMMC using the SD Partition.
- Also tired once using the SD File option
- Tried using a different SD card to rule that out

Atmosphere
- Tried using the drag/drop Deep Sea advanced version. Tried using the automatic updater to update EVERYTHING I could.
- Tried using HATS package
- Tried vanilla installing Hekate, then Atmosphere, then found Sigpatches and pasted them over

Settings
- I've tried disabling all sysmodules
- Linking the user account using linkalho
- I've tried launching the switch into debug mode to clear out 🤷‍♂️
- I've ran the lockpick payload and read the keys, including the mariko partial keys.


I'm hoping that there's some easy thing that has to be done and is unique to mariko switches? lol I'm 3 days into this now.

I guess the one thing I've not tried is running "initialize" on my sysnand. I think the debug menu had this option (start with both vol+/- held down),
